Output fa8a5bf23bd54fafe64f982451e65fa8407acf674ba1419e78b622ab3c345c5d:2

value
21689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e9127968803e984f3b7619e2b0da3a844b9a24f OP_EQUAL
address
37PqhxYbb3hxSYVA1Gfq11NfELTF5yBLqC
transaction
fa8a5bf23bd54fafe64f982451e65fa8407acf674ba1419e78b622ab3c345c5d
confirmations
197360
spent
true